Transaction 649846bc1dcfcc289bf12d613d9f3f63e32569c4c774dffbe557125d4e9b3243

1 Input
2 Outputs
  • 649846bc1dcfcc289bf12d613d9f3f63e32569c4c774dffbe557125d4e9b3243:0
  • value  518820
    address  14ssAPWZHhcYeFEyfoSXAd39fogiaiAmCZ
  • 649846bc1dcfcc289bf12d613d9f3f63e32569c4c774dffbe557125d4e9b3243:1
  • value  1144801
    address  1fRdZgmSaxFnJVyEyEhVrMRpoLhBiTSgw